@@ -27,6 +27,8 @@ By default, all pages will appear as top level pages in the main nav.
To specify a page order, use the `nav_order` variable in your pages' YAML front matter.

For specific pages that you do not wish to include in the main navigation, e.g. a 404 page. Use the `nav_exclude: true` parameter in the YAML front matter for that page.
